// Client setup for the Frostbin archiver job at Quillmark Data.
// New folks: this client moves buckets older than 180 days from warm
// storage into the cold-archive tier via our internal tiering service.
// It runs nightly, is idempotent, and skips any bucket tagged "hold".
// Always test against the sandbox tier first; restores from cold take
// hours. The credential is read-write on archive paths only.
// The key for the tiering service is below.

API key for tagef-fafop: vxb2-ta

- [ ] Step 7: Archive cold storage buckets (Glacierline tier). Confirm both ceremony witnesses are present, verify bucket manifests match the Oxbow ledger, then seal the archive key shares. Plugin authors may observe but not handle shares. Once sealed, the archive index itself is encrypted and can only be reopened with the passphrase below.

vault phrase of badup-hahig = tamael-aldael-kelmir-istael-fenok-istwyn-tamius-jorath-oliion

# Artifact Signing — Lattice-View Releases

Lattice-View, our dependency graph visualizer, ships as a signed tarball to the Fennridge package mirror. Before tagging a release, confirm the graph-render regression suite passed on the release branch and that the manifest lists every bundled asset. Unsigned or partially signed artifacts will be quarantined by the mirror's intake check. Sign the final tarball and its checksum file with the current release key, reproduced below.

release key, fajef-kajeg: bky19_LdLu6Ne6FLi8he2c24d